Global warming is increasing the levels of greenhouse gases in the atmosphere, leading to more heat being trapped and higher temperatures. This can result in the degradation of air quality through increased smog, higher levels of ozone, and worsened air pollution, which can impact human health and the environment.
Clean air does not prevent global warming. In fact, dirty polluted air in the mid-20th century actually slowed global warming a little as it reflected solar radiation away from the earth. Various Clean Air Acts around the world stopped this global cooling, and the warming continued.
